Types of Cat Flaps
There are numerous kinds of cat flaps readily available on the marketplace, consisting of:
Manual Cat Flap: A manual cat flap is the a lot of fundamental kind of cat flap and needs your cat to push through a flap to enter or exit your house.Automatic Cat Flap: An automatic cat flap uses a sensor to discover your cat's existence and opens and closes instantly.Microchip Cat Flap: A microchip cat flap utilizes a microchip placed into your cat's skin to find their presence and open the flap.Magnetic Cat Flap: A magnetic cat flap uses a magnet to detect your cat's existence and open the flap.

Step-by-Step Installation Process
Installing a cat flap is a reasonably simple process that can be finished in a couple of hours. Here is a detailed guide:
Choose the area: Choose a place for the cat flap that is safe and convenient for your cat. Ideally, this ought to be a door or wall that leads directly outside.Step the area: Measure the location where you plan to install the cat flap to ensure that it fits snugly.Mark the area: Use a pencil and marker to mark the area where you plan to install the cat flap.Cut the hole: Use a saw or jigsaw to cut a hole in the door or wall that is a little larger than the cat flap.Install the cat flap: Place the cat flap in the hole and protect it with screws or nails.Add weatherproofing products: If wanted, include weatherproofing materials such as caulk or weatherstripping to avoid air leaks and wetness from entering the house.Test the cat flap: Test the cat flap to make sure that it is working correctly and that your cat can get in and leave the house safely.

Often Asked Questions
Here are a couple of often asked questions about cat flaps and their installation:
Q: What is the best type of cat flap for my cat?A: The best kind of cat flap for your cat will depend upon their specific requirements and choices. Consider aspects such as size, ease of use, and security when picking a cat flap.
Q: How do I set up a cat flap in a brick wall?A: Installing a cat flap in a brick wall can be more tough than installing one in a door or wooden wall. You may need to use a specialized drill bit and anchor to protect the cat flap in location.
Q: Can I set up a cat flap myself?A: Yes, setting up a cat flap is a reasonably uncomplicated process that can be completed by a DIY enthusiast. Nevertheless, if you are not comfy with tools or are unsure about the installation process, it might be best to hire a professional.
Q: How much does a cat flap cost?A: The cost of a cat flap can vary depending on the type and quality of the item. Usually, a standard cat flap can cost in between ₤ 20 and ₤ 50, while a more advanced design can cost upwards of ₤ 100.
